Despite the new tax rate reductions of the Jobs and Growth Tax Relief Reconciliation Act of 2003, the top marginal tax bracket for many retirees is a whopping 46.3 per cent. Why? Because Social Security benefits are subject to income tax. Those affected are Social Security recipients who have the good fortune (misfortune?) to be subject to both the 25 per cent income tax bracket and the 85 per cent inclusion rate for Social Security benefits. Related Article Tags: , , , Income tax was levied on non-residents and American citizens living and working in a foreign country and for the federal government. During World War I, the government requested that citizens volunteer to pay taxes as a way to pay for the war. During World War II the government employed Walt Disney and his cartoon character, Donald Duck, to increase the voluntary payment of the income tax.
